What We Offer : Competitive health & wellness benefits, 401(k) & company match Paid Sick Days, Vacation, and Holidays, Paid Bereavement, Paid Pet Bereavement Training & Development opportunities, career growth Tuition Reimbursement Pet Insurance Team Member Hotel Rates, other discounts, perks and more What   We’re   Looking For:   A hands-on and detail-driven Executive Steward who will lead the stewarding team and ensure the highest standards of cleanliness, organization, and safety across all kitchen and food preparation areas. In this role,   you’ll   oversee the care and maintenance of kitchen equipment, dishware, and storage spaces, creating an environment that supports flawless culinary and banquet operations. Your leadership will keep back-of-house operations running smoothly, enabling exceptional guest experiences.   Who You Are:   Decisive Leader : You make quick, effective decisions under pressure, keeping operations smooth during peak service times or unexpected challenges.    Accountable Leader : You inspire pride and accountability, ensuring your team consistently delivers the highest standards of cleanliness and sanitation.     Collaborative Communicator : You connect seamlessly with team members, vendors, and other departments to achieve shared goals.    Detail-Oriented Organizer : You manage multiple priorities with efficiency,   maintaining   processes that drive consistency and excellence.    Safety Advocate : You uphold local health codes and food safety regulations, ensuring compliance and preventing violations at every turn.   What   You’ll   Do:   Lead and manage the stewarding department, ensuring proper coverage and smooth, efficient operations.    Inspire and motivate your team,   fostering   collaboration   and   maintaining   high morale through regular meetings, training, and coaching.    Develop work schedules that align staffing levels with operational needs for daily service, banquets, and special events.     Oversee dishwashing operations to guarantee the proper cleaning and storage of all plates, glassware, silverware, and kitchen equipment.    Ensure safe handling and storage of cleaning chemicals,   maintaining   compliance with all safety standards and regulations.    Manage inventory of cleaning supplies, dishware, glassware, and kitchen equipment, keeping   accurate   records and coordinating repairs or replacements as needed.    Partner with vendors and   purchasing   teams to ensure   timely   ordering and delivery of supplies and equipment.    Collaborate with the Executive Chef and other department leaders to meet operational goals and support seamless service.    Work closely with banquet teams to coordinate equipment needs for events, including setup and breakdown of service areas.    Train team members on cleaning procedures, equipment handling, and safety practices, reinforcing a culture of accountability and excellence.    Implement and monitor safety programs to prevent accidents and   maintain   a secure work environment.    Manage departmental budgets by monitoring labor, supply, and equipment costs, minimizing   waste   and controlling expenses through efficient resource management.    Track breakage and loss of dishware, glassware, and kitchen equipment, ensuring proper handling and storage procedures.    Uphold health, hygiene, sanitation, and safety regulations (OSHA and local health codes) across all stewarding operations and back-of-house areas.   Demonstrates regular and reliable attendance.   Other duties as assigned.   Your Experience Includes :   High School Diploma or equivalent. Degree in Hospitality/Restaurant Management, and/or relevant work experience, preferred.   Minimum 2-4 years of experience in a manager role within Stewarding, Food & Beverage, Culinary, or a related professional area within an upscale hotel or restaurant, preferred.   Strong understanding of kitchen operations, sanitation standards, and equipment maintenance.   Knowledge of health department regulations and food safety standards.   Excellent communication, interpersonal skills, and strong organizational and time management abilities.    Physical ability to perform duties, including lifting heavy items, standing for   long periods , and   operating   cleaning equipment.   Flexibility to   work   varying shifts, including nights, weekends, and holidays, as needed.    Who   You’ll   Supervise :   Stewarding Department
